Spicy Chicken with Garlic Sauce
Spicy Chicken with Garlic Sauce is a flavorful dish that combines tender chicken pieces with a bold, spicy garlic sauce, making it a perfect choice for a satisfying dinner. This Halal Chinese dish is both aromatic and delightful, sure to please any palate.

Ingredients
- Chicken breast - 300 grams, cut into bite-sized pieces
- Garlic - 5 cloves, minced
- Fresh ginger - 1 inch, minced
- Red bell pepper - 1, sliced
- Green bell pepper - 1, sliced
- Soy sauce - 2 tablespoons
- Chili paste - 1 tablespoon
- Cornstarch - 1 tablespoon
- Vegetable oil - 2 tablespoons
- Spring onions - 2, chopped
- Sesame oil - 1 teaspoon
- Salt - to taste
- Black pepper - to taste
Steps
- In a bowl, combine the chicken pieces with soy sauce, chili paste, cornstarch, salt, and black pepper. Mix well and let it marinate for 15 minutes.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the marinated chicken and cook for 5-7 minutes until golden brown and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add the remaining tablespoon of vegetable oil. Sauté the minced garlic and ginger for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
- Add the sliced red and green bell peppers to the skillet. Stir-fry for 3-4 minutes until they are slightly tender but still crisp.
- Return the cooked chicken to the skillet, stirring to combine all ingredients. Drizzle with sesame oil and add chopped spring onions.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es to heat through.
- Adjust seasoning if necessary, then remove from heat and serve hot.
